    Philadelphia Union vs CF Montreal prediction: form gap favours hosts

    Philadelphia Union welcome CF Montreal to a fixture where the table shows barely daylight between the sides but the form profile points sharply in one direction. The hosts sit 14th on 13 points from 17 matches, one place and two points below their visitors, yet Formatic's weighted last-five score puts them at 6.44 out of 10 while Montreal languish at 2.67. That gap of 3.77 represents steady recent progress against a side struggling to find any rhythm at all, and the numbers suggest the table may not reflect current reality for much longer.

    Philadelphia have scored in all five of their most recent outings, putting 12 past opponents and conceding the same number for a record of two wins, one draw and two defeats. The victories have come in their last two, both at home: a composed 1-0 against Seattle Sounders on 25 July and a more expansive 3-1 over New York Red Bulls three days earlier. Before that the defensive line was porous, shipping four at Orlando City in a 3-4 loss and six at Inter Miami despite scoring four themselves in a 4-6 defeat, but the tightening up across the last fortnight suggests adjustments have taken hold. Over the season they have scored 22 and conceded 31 in 17 matches, rates of 1.29 and 1.82 per game that leave them with a goal difference of minus nine.

    CF Montreal arrive in the opposite trajectory, their poor form band confirmed by back-to-back 1-0 defeats at the hands of Inter Miami at home and Nashville away in late July, either side of a goalless draw with Toronto. In league play they have managed only four goals across their last five and kept a single clean sheet, and they have failed to score in 40 percent of their matches this season. The two wins in that spell both came in the Canadian Championship, 2-1 home and away against Vancouver FC in early July, and those friendlies carry less weight than the league struggles. Across 17 MLS fixtures Montreal have scored 22 and conceded 33, a 1.94 goals-against average that ranks among the leakiest in a 30-team competition, and their seven-match sample shows them generating 1.71 expected goals per outing from 16 shots and 4.7 on target.

    The head to head record leans heavily toward Philadelphia, who have won six of the last ten meetings against three for Montreal and one draw. Those ten fixtures have averaged 3.6 goals, with both teams scoring in seven and over 2.5 goals landing in eight. The five most recent clashes all finished with a Philadelphia win or a Montreal win by more than one goal: CF Montreal took a 4-2 victory at Philadelphia on 10 February 2026, but before that the hosts had won 2-1 at home in July 2025, 2-1 away in May 2025 and 1-0 away in February 2025, while the most recent meeting on 11 April ended 2-1 to Philadelphia in Montreal.

    With the hosts averaging 1.29 goals scored per game and Montreal conceding 1.94, and both sides leaking freely, the goals profile points to chances at both ends. Philadelphia's recent defensive improvement and Montreal's scoring drought complicate that picture, but the head to head pattern of high-scoring encounters and the visitors' 33 conceded in 17 matches suggest the home side can find space. The form gap of nearly four points, the head to head dominance and the contrast between steady and poor over the last five all point toward a Philadelphia performance that could move them closer to the middle of the table at the expense of opponents sliding the other way.
